Demon Slayer: The Hinokami Chronicles 2 Launches on Consoles and PC

SEGA has officially released Demon Slayer -Kimetsu no Yaiba- The Hinokami Chronicles 2, bringing the next chapter of the beloved anime series to life on PlayStation 5, PlayStation 4, Xbox Series X|S, Xbox One, and PC via Steam. The sequel builds on the success of its predecessor with new story arcs, enhanced combat, and post-launch updates that promise even more content for fans.

Relive Iconic Arcs from the Anime

The Hinokami Chronicles 2 lets players experience pivotal moments from the Entertainment District Arc, Swordsmith Village Arc, and Hashira Training Arc, complete with the series’ trademark cinematic flair and fast-paced combat. Players once again take control of Tanjiro Kamado and other fan-favorite characters as they battle powerful demons across these stunningly recreated storylines.

Infinity Castle Character Pass and Free Updates Incoming

SEGA isn’t stopping at launch content. The game will receive the Infinity Castle Arc Character Pass, expanding the roster with new characters from one of the most anticipated story arcs in the Demon Slayer saga.

In addition, Muzan Kibutsuji, the main antagonist of the series, will join the Versus Mode lineup in a free post-launch update, giving fans the chance to wield the power of the ultimate demon for the first time.

What Platforms Is It On?

Demon Slayer -Kimetsu no Yaiba- The Hinokami Chronicles 2 is now available on PS5, PS4, Xbox Series X|S, Xbox One, and PC (Steam). Players can dive in immediately and look forward to more updates in the coming months.
